Pricing from SA suppliers are:

OFFICE 2013 HOME AND BUSINESS EDITION - FPP ~ R1,749.00 Excl. VAT
OFFICE 2013 HOME AND STUDENT EDITION - FPP ~ R719.00 Excl. VAT
OFFICE 2013 PROFESSIONAL EDITION - FPP ~ R3,199.00 Excl. VAT
